对于即将踏入大学校门的准大一新生来说,科研竞赛是一个充满机遇和挑战的领域。计算机专业大学生比赛种类繁多,涵盖了编程、算法、网络安全、人工智能等多个方面。对于计算机专业的大学生来说,参加这些比赛不仅能够锻炼自己的技术能力,还能够拓宽视野,增强竞争力。这些比赛不仅为学生提供了展示才华的平台,也促进了学术交流和技能提升,而且如果表现优异的话,还会在升学中起到一定的的助推作用!接下来自主选拔在线团队为大家汇总整理常见的大学生计算机类竞赛,大家赶紧收藏!
大学生计算机类竞赛
1. 全国大学生电子设计竞赛:
由教育部和工业和信息化部共同发起,对于电子信息工程与通信工程等理工科专业的学生有优势。在全国大赛中获得金牌、银牌的团队或个人,是保研的重点参考依据。
官网是:http://www.nuedcchina.com/
2. ACM-ICPC 国际大学生程序设计竞赛:
是公认的最具含金量的大学生计算机竞赛,难度极大。此竞赛与计算机、软件、电子信息等相关专业密切相关,国内外知名企业如谷歌、华为、阿里、腾讯等对其成绩非常重视,甚至将其视为人才招聘的重要依据。能在该大赛中获得好名次的学生,就业时能获得更多优质岗位与更高薪酬待遇,在保研上也更具优势。
其官网为:https://acm.cumt.edu.cn/
3. 全国大学生机器人大赛:
包含 RoboMaster、Robocon 等多个分项赛事,是中国最具影响力的机器人项目和独创的机器人竞技平台,涉及机械、电子、控制等多学科知识,培养学生的创新能力和团队合作精神。
4. 中国大学生计算机设计大赛:
涵盖多种计算机相关领域,如软件设计、多媒体设计等,展示学生的计算机应用和创新能力。
官网是:http://jsjds.blcu.edu.cn/
5. 中国高校计算机大赛:
包括大数据挑战赛、团体程序设计天梯赛、移动应用创新赛、网络技术挑战赛、人工智能创意赛等多个分项赛事,激发学生的计算机技术创新能力。
官网是:http://www.c4best.cn/
6. 蓝桥杯全国软件和信息技术专业人才大赛:
为软件和信息技术专业的学生提供了一个展示和竞技的平台,提升学生的编程技能和实践能力。
官网是:http://dasai.lanqiao.cn/
7. 全国大学生信息安全竞赛:
增强学生的信息安全意识和防护能力,培养信息安全领域的专业人才。
官网是:http://www.ciscn.cn/
8. 全国大学生集成电路创新创业大赛:
推动集成电路领域的人才培养和技术创新,培养学生在芯片设计、应用等方面的能力。
官网是:http://univ.ciciec.com/
9. 中国机器人及人工智能大赛:
涵盖机器人技术和人工智能的多个方面,鼓励学生探索和创新。
计算机类竞赛的重要性体现在哪些方面?
(一)增加保研中的竞争力
在保研竞争中,成绩优秀的学生非常多。因此,拥有含金量高的计算机类竞赛的获奖经历,能使你在众多申请者中脱颖而出,这不仅向招生老师展示了你在理论学习上的出色表现,还展示了你具备将知识应用于实践、解决实际问题的能力。甚至可以说,计算机类保研,拥有竞赛经历,只是最基本的条件。
国防科技大学计算机学院2022年优秀大学生夏令营组织方案
(二)体现专业能力
竞赛要求学生综合运用计算机专业知识,包括编程语言、数据结构、算法、数据库等。在竞赛中取得好成绩,证明了你对这些核心知识的熟练掌握和灵活运用,体现出扎实的专业基础和较强的技术能力。机考也是许多计算机类夏令营的环节之一,因此参加竞赛也能够提升我们的机考能力。
(三)展示创新思维
许多计算机类竞赛鼓励创新,要求参赛者提出新颖的解决方案。这展示了你具备独立思考和创新的能力,能够在面对复杂问题时突破常规,为解决问题提供独特的思路和方法。
(四)彰显团队协作精神
大部分竞赛以团队形式进行,需要成员之间密切合作、分工明确、互相支持。在竞赛中的良好团队表现,反映了你具备团队协作的能力,懂得如何在团队中发挥自己的优势,促进团队共同进步。
(五)证明学习积极性和主动性
主动参与竞赛表明你对计算机领域有浓厚的兴趣和积极的学习态度。这显示了你不满足于课堂所学,愿意主动探索、挑战自我,追求更高水平的专业成长。
(六)拓展学术视野
竞赛往往涉及前沿的技术和应用场景,参与其中能让你接触到行业的最新动态和发展趋势。在保研面试中,你可以分享这些前沿知识和见解,展现出广阔的学术视野,给面试官留下深刻印象。
(七)弥补成绩短板
如果在课程成绩方面稍有不足,出色的竞赛成绩可以在一定程度上弥补这一短板。它证明了你在实践方面的优秀表现,为你的综合能力加分。
(八)获取未来导师的关注
在竞赛中表现出色可能会引起相关专业导师的关注。导师更倾向于招收有实践能力和创新精神的学生,这增加了你被心仪导师选中的机会,提前为研究生阶段的学习打下良好基础。综上所述,计算机类竞赛对于计算机类学生的保研具有显著的推动作用,是提升个人竞争力、实现保研目标的重要途径之一。
零基础可以参加计算机大赛吗?
其实这里的零基础指的是大一刚刚步入校园的大学生,其实对于大一学生而言,虽然经验不足,但是可以通过一些方式进行准备:
大一上学期
选择一门编程语言,如 Python,通过在线课程和书籍系统学习其基础语法和编程概念。参加学校开设的计算机基础课程,如“计算机导论”,了解计算机的基本原理和体系结构。
在在线编程平台(如 LeetCode)上进行简单的编程练习,巩固所学知识。尝试使用 Python 解决一些数学计算和逻辑推理问题。
大一下学期
学习 Python 的高级特性,如面向对象编程、异常处理、文件操作等。接触数据结构和算法,通过相关书籍和课程初步了解常见的数据结构(如链表、栈、队列)和简单算法(如冒泡排序、选择排序)。
加入学校的计算机相关社团,如编程社团、算法社团等,与学长学姐交流学习经验。参加社团组织的编程竞赛和技术讲座,拓宽视野。